Female Rock Group Sweet Revenge Releases "Rule Breaker" Mini Album and MV

When it comes to bands being highlighted in the modern K-pop word, who do you think of? I am sure most would think of a group like CN Blue or FT Island, but get ready for Sweet Revenge, a female rock group who are poised to take mainstream success.

Sweet Revenge’s first mini album ‘Rule Breaker’ was produced by Kim Sung Soo, who previously produced for Lee Juk and Kim Dong Ryul, and sound engineer, Ted Jensen, who previously worked with world famous artists Marilyn Manson, Metallica, and Seo Taiji.”

When your first mini album is engineered by someone who has worked with Marilyn Manson, Metallica, and Seo Taiji, that can only be a strong indication of what to expect. But, for those who don’t know, who are the girls who make up Sweet Revenge?

A nickname that has been attached to them is the, “SNSD of Hongdae.” This is because of their Hongdae origins, and also because of the vocalist’s resemblance to SNSD’s Taeyeon.

The band consists of drummer, Jang Hyun Ah, bassist Lee Hwa Yeon, guitarist Kim Mi Jung, and the Taeyeon lookalike, Kim So Young.

Since their indie origins in 2009, the group has released two small EPs, which despite the indie origins, got them a large fan base in Hongdae. Their music had stirred up interest for this mini album. To show off  how ready they are to perform with the big acts, their title track, “Rule Breaker” was made entirely by the members.

The mini album was released on August 25 and has four tracks:
